Ground Turkey Enchiladas Casserole

A comforting and nutritious casserole featuring ground turkey, black beans, and a zesty enchilada sauce layered with corn tortillas and cheese.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Course Dinner, Main Course
Cuisine Comfort Food, Mexican
Servings 6 servings
Calories 350 kcal

Ingredients
  

Main Ingredients

  • 1 lb Ground turkey A healthier twist on traditional meat.
  • 1 can (15 oz) black beans Drain and rinse to remove excess sodium.
  • 1 can (10 oz) enchilada sauce Use mild or spicy based on preference.
  • 1 cup corn Fresh or frozen adds sweetness.
  • 1 cup diced tomatoes Freshness adds acidity.
  • 1 cup shredded cheese Choose cheddar or a Mexican blend.
  • 8 pieces corn tortillas Cut in half to fit casserole dish.
  • 1 tsp chili powder Gives the dish a warm spice.
  • 1 tsp cumin Adds depth and smokiness.
  • to taste Salt and pepper Essential for flavor.

Instructions
 

Preparation

  •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
  • In a skillet over medium heat, brown the ground turkey and add chili powder, cumin, salt, and pepper.

Mixing

  • In a bowl, combine black beans, corn, diced tomatoes, and half of the enchilada sauce.

Layering

  • Cut the tortillas in half to fit the casserole dish. Layer half of tortillas in the bottom, then half of turkey mixture, half of bean mixture, and top with cheese.
  • Repeat layers and finish with remaining enchilada sauce and cheese.

Baking

  • Cover the dish with foil and bake for 20 minutes.
  • Remove foil and bake for another 10 minutes, until cheese is bubbly and golden.

Serving

  • Let the casserole cool for a few minutes before serving.

Notes

This casserole tastes even better the next day. Serve with sour cream, cilantro, or avocado. Pairs well with Mexican-style rice or a light salad.
